Product details

Stamped Socket for Multimate III+ Harnesses

Crimp termination means this socket is installed with a standard crimp tool — no solder iron needed, and the joint is repeatable in a harness build. The 20-24 AWG range covers common stranded wire sizes for signal and moderate power circuits. The brass base material is typical for stamped contacts, offering good conductivity and formability for the crimp barrel.

What connectors are 1-66563-1 compatible with?

This stamped socket is part of the Multimate III+ series and mates with the corresponding Multimate III+ pin contact. It fits into any Multimate III+ housing that accepts a stamped socket — typically used in TE's CPC (Circular Plastic Connector) and other industrial connector families.
